REV ION - Home

Tackling the challenges of the FIRST Robotics Competition requires rapid iteration, numerous revisions, and adaptation to the game challenges. Recognizing that not all teams have access to the same equipment or resources, we created REV ION to enable and empower all teams to be competitive.

REV ION is a system of mechanical and electrical products that are perfectly compatible with each other, allowing for complex robot designs without large budgets or extensive manufacturing resources. With basic tools, teams can build affordable, competitive machines while preserving the ability to infinitely reconfigure and iterate on their designs.

Look for the REV ION flag and logo on our website and shop with confidence, knowing all products are compatible and designed to work together seamlessly.

REV Robotics is proud to supply for the FIRST Robotics Competition (FRC). For more information about the FIRST Robotics Competition, please visit the FIRST Robotics Competition website.

FRC Kickoff Concepts

REV Robotics is dedicated to helping robotics teams get a head start on building their robots for the current year's challenge by providing CAD models, videos, prototypes, and other materials. These concepts are designed to remove some of the frustrations of starting a new build season, while still maintaining the challenge and fun of the competition. The goal of our Kickoff Concepts project is to assist all teams, students, and mentors with ideas and resources to consider as the season progresses, regardless of their skill level or experience.
